Gauteng – The music industry and communities across Gauteng are mourning the loss of DJ Warras, a gifted disc jockey whose sound, spirit and dedication left an indelible mark on local music culture.
DJ Warras was more than a selector of songs — he was a storyteller through sound, a cultural bridge who understood the pulse of the streets and translated it into rhythm, celebration and connection. Whether behind the decks at community events, clubs, private functions or township gatherings, his music created moments that brought people together.
Known for his versatility and deep appreciation of local sounds, DJ Warras championed emerging talent while paying homage to the roots of South African music. He carried his craft with humility, professionalism and an infectious passion that earned him respect from fellow DJs, artists and supporters alike.
Beyond the music, those who knew him speak of a man who was generous with his time, supportive of upcoming creatives and deeply connected to his community. He believed in using music not only for entertainment, but as a tool for unity, healing and expression.
His passing leaves a profound silence in spaces that once echoed with his sound. Yet, his legacy lives on — in the playlists he curated, the artists he inspired, and the countless memories created on dance floors where his music brought joy and escape.
